Ad NetworksLikeAdsenseGoogle have revolutionized the world of online advertising, allowing businesses to reach a wide audience and generate revenue. These networks have become an essential tool in the digital marketing realm, offering a platform for publishers and advertisers to connect and collaborate.
One of the most attention-grabbing facts about Ad NetworksLikeAdsenseGoogle is their immense popularity and reach. Google Adsense, for instance, has over 14 million websites that are currently utilizing its services. This staggering number highlights the significance and widespread adoption of these advertising networks.
Ad Networks Like AdsenseGoogle emerged as a solution to the growing demand for effective online advertising platforms. In the early days of the internet, businesses faced challenges in targeting their desired audience and promoting their products or services. However, with the advent of these networks, advertisers found a perfect medium to display their ads on relevant websites, maximizing their visibility and impact.
The rise of Ad Networks Like Adsense Google can be attributed to the increasing reliance on internet-based technologies and the subsequent growth of online advertising. As more people started using the internet for various purposes, online marketing became a powerful tool for businesses to expand their customer base. Ad networks played a crucial role in this process, providing a platform that facilitated targeting, tracking, and optimizing ad campaigns for maximum effectiveness.
One compelling statistic that demonstrates the influence of Ad Networks Like Adsense Google is the staggering global digital ad spending. In 2020, the total expenditure on digital advertising amounted to a whopping $332.84 billion. This figure showcases the massive investment businesses are making in online advertising, leveraging platforms like Google Adsense to reach their target audience effectively.
Today, Ad Networks Like Adsense Google offer an array of innovative features and tools that help businesses achieve their advertising goals. These networks use advanced algorithms to match advertisers with relevant websites, ensuring that their ads are displayed to a receptive audience. Furthermore, they provide comprehensive analytics and reporting tools, enabling advertisers to monitor the performance of their campaigns and make data-driven decisions for optimal results.

FAQs
1. What is an ad network?
An ad network is a platform that connects advertisers with publishers, allowing advertisers to display their ads on various websites.
2. How does an ad network like Adsense Google work?
An ad network like Adsense Google works by using algorithms to match relevant ads with website content. When a visitor clicks on an ad, the website owner earns revenue.
3. Can anyone join an ad network?
Yes, most ad networks accept applications from both advertisers and publishers. However, they may have certain eligibility criteria that need to be met.
4. How can I join an ad network as an advertiser?
To join an ad network as an advertiser, you usually need to sign up on their website, create an ad campaign, set a budget, and select the target audience for your ads.
5. What are the benefits of using an ad network?
Using an ad network offers several benefits, such as reaching a larger audience, targeting specific demographics or interests, and getting detailed analytics about your ad performance.
6. How do ad networks ensure ad relevancy?
Ad networks use various techniques like contextual targeting, behavior targeting, and demographic targeting to ensure ad relevancy. They analyze website content, user browsing behavior, and demographic information to display relevant ads.
7. Can I control the types of ads displayed on my website as a publisher?
Yes, as a publisher, you can have some control over the types of ads displayed on your website. You can block certain categories of ads or choose specific types of ads that align with your website’s content.
8. How do ad networks calculate revenue for publishers?
Ad networks typically pay publishers based on the number of ad impressions or the number of clicks on ads displayed on their websites. The exact revenue calculation may vary between ad networks.
9. What is the minimum traffic requirement to join an ad network as a publisher?
The minimum traffic requirement to join an ad network as a publisher can vary. Some ad networks may have no specific traffic requirements, while others may require a certain number of monthly page views.
10. How can I track the performance of my ads as an advertiser?
Ad networks provide advertisers with detailed analytics and reporting tools to track the performance of their ads. You can monitor metrics like impressions, clicks, click-through rates, and conversions.
11. Can I use multiple ad networks on my website?
Yes, you can use multiple ad networks on your website. This allows you to diversify your revenue streams and compare the performance of different ad networks.
12. How do ad networks prevent click fraud?
Ad networks employ various measures like click fraud detection algorithms, IP filtering, and manual review processes to prevent click fraud. They monitor click patterns and take action against any suspicious activity.
13. Do ad networks support mobile advertising?
Yes, most ad networks support mobile advertising. They offer ad formats and targeting options specifically designed for mobile devices to help advertisers reach their target audience effectively.
14. How do ad networks ensure ad quality?
Ad networks have ad quality guidelines that advertisers and publishers must follow. They review ads to ensure they meet these guidelines, preventing the display of misleading or inappropriate ads.
15. Can I earn a significant income from ad networks as a publisher?
Earning income from ad networks as a publisher can vary depending on factors like website traffic, ad placement, and ad relevancy. While some publishers can earn a significant income, it may take time and effort to achieve desirable results.
